Weather Outlook – the Week Ahead: Warm(er)

By Chris Sorensen

After a weekend of snow and below-freezing temperatures, including a reading of -23 at Lamar Sunday morning, a slight warmup will take hold for much of the work week.

Sunday’s high will remain below the freezing mark as the temperature struggles to reach 20, then falls to the negative single digits overnight.

Look for mid-30s Monday under sunny skies, and mid-teens overnight.

The warming continues for Tuesday through Thursday, with daily temperatures in the mid-40s, potentially approaching 50 Tuesday. Overnight lows will be in the teens.

Home Country

by Slim Randles

“I can’t stand winter,” said Herb Collins, who had dropped in at the Mule Barn’s philosophy counter for a quick cup. “There’s nothing to do.”

“Get out and enjoy it,” suggested Doc. “Go skiing. Go ice fishing. Build a snowman. Do something. Then you’ll feel better.”

“I don’t think your advice will take,” said Dud. “Herb seems to be intransigent on this one.”

We all looked at Dud.

“You see, he said he couldn’t stand winter,” Dud continued, “which shows he has a proclivity for intransigence on that particular subject.”

Farm Bureau, Lamar Elks Hosting Toy Show Fundraiser

Prowers County Farm Bureau is sponsoring the Lamar Elks Toy Show, to be held Saturday, January 7, 2017, at the Lamar Elks Lodge 28157 Hwy 287 South in Lamar. The show will start at 8:00 a.m. and run until 3:00 p.m.

Toys of all shapes and sizes, including new-in-the-box, hand built, 3D printed, collectables, antiques, children’s play toys and many other types of collectables will be available to buy, trade or just admire.

A $2 admission fee will be charged, however children under 10 will be admitted free.

Sales tables available for $25 each.

Movie Review - Office Christmas Party

By Bob Garver

For years, I thought that Jason Bateman, Jennifer Aniston, and Courtney B. Vance all seemed like nice people. I know nobody’s perfect, but I didn’t have any problems with them. Now having seen them in “Office Christmas Party,” I have to assume that they are in fact horrible people. They’re not necessarily horrible because they did this movie, but they’re horrible because of something they did before this movie. They did something horrible and now have to do this movie as part of a blackmail.
